2017-06-13 53 views
0

With flatList並呈現約100項左右。一旦我們使用了渲染區域外的scrollToOffset,scrollToIndex函數將只爲您提供最初渲染項目的最後一幀。這是一個限制,還是我做錯了什麼?React-Native:平板列表ScrollToPosition不滾動到實際位置

這可以修復,但將initialNumToRender設置爲支持100多個項目的非常大的數字,但在這種情況下,性能會受到影響。

當前狀況: 我們渲染了100個對象放置在flatList中。它們的大小是動態的,所以使用getItemLayout/scrollToIndex是不可能的。當用戶移出頁面,然後返回時,我們希望維護該位置。但在Android上,如果它是名單上非常重要的一個項目,它不會保持這個位置,並且會使我們處於最初渲染位置的末尾。

版本: 陣營母語:0.44 陣營:16.0.0-alpha.6

回答